自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 收藏
  • 关注

原创 黑马程序员-----OC学习之类的封装

1.综述面向过程(ProcedureOriented)就是分析出解决问题所需要的步骤,然后用函数把这些步骤一步一步实现,使用的时候一个一个依次调用就可以了。 面向对象(ObjectOriented,简称OO)是把构成问题事务分解成各个对象,建立对象的目的不是为了完成一个步骤,而是为了描叙某个事物在整个解决问题的步骤中的行为。面向过程关注的是解决问题需要哪些步骤;面向对象

2015-08-19 11:47:20 337

原创 黑马程序员-----OC学习之Foundation中的类

Foundation中的类:NSString:不可变字符串://快速创建 NSString *str = @"this is just a demo"; //格式化创建 int a=2; NSString *str2 = [[NSString alloc]initWithFormat:@"this is a demo%d",a ];

2015-08-19 10:30:31 328

原创 黑马程序员-----C语言学习之流程控制

流程控制顺序结构:默认的流程结构。按照书写顺序执行每一条语句。选择结构:对给定的条件进行判断,再根据判断结果来决定执行哪一段代码。循环结构:在给定条件成立的情况下,反复执行某一段代码。1、顺序结构:默认的流程结构。按照书写顺序执行每一条语句。2、 分支结构:if(表达式/常量/变量){语句块}

2015-08-19 09:46:33 315

原创 黑马程序员-----OC学习之Foundation中的结构体

Foundation中的结构体:NSRange结构体:1.定义:是用来计算字符串范围的;它有两个成员,一个是location表示开始位置,一个是lenth表示长度;2.举例说明:定义一个字符串 NSString *str = @“i love oc”;          定义一个结构体变量 NSRange range = NSMakeRange(2,4)//NSMakeRange是

2015-08-07 16:38:31 415

原创 黑马程序员-----OC学习之内存管理

内存管理:   1.计数器相关指令:当我们创建一个对象如Person *p = [[Person alloc] init]之后,我们的系统默认计数器为1     retain:计数器加1 :[p retain];  retain方法会返回对象本身;     release:计数器减1;[p release];     retainCount:查询当前计数器的个数:用NSUInteg

2015-08-04 12:03:24 270

原创 黑马程序员-----OC学习之类与对象

1.为什么要使用import,import和include的区别?        首先 两者都是引入头文件,但是import又引入的头文件可以防止重复包含;        include他是使用预处理指令防止重复包含,如果没有写预处理指令,则无法防止重复包含问题。2.foundation/foundation.h是头文件;        它的作用是:把foundation.

2015-07-30 19:24:15 365

原创 黑马程序员-----C语言学习之通讯录应用的代码实现

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 4

2015-07-28 21:19:31 516

原创 黑马程序员-----OC学习之类的继承和多态

我们都知道,面向对象程序设计中的类有三大特性:继承,封装,多态。今天主要总结一下继承和多态。一.继承1.基本概念程序的世界和人类的“对象”世界在思想上是没有设么区别的,富二代继承了父母,自然就拥有了父母拥有的所有资源,子类继承了父类同样就拥有了父类所有的方法和属性(成员变量)。继承是类中的一个重要的特性,他的出现使得我们没必要别写重复的代码,可重用性很高。在这里动物

2015-07-26 21:53:05 280

原创 黑马程序员-----C语言学习之数组与指针

讲他们之间的关系之前先了解下面几个名词的概念,通过实例分析他们之间到底存在什么联系 数组指针:           指向数组元素的指针    数组指针的作用:       使用数组指针间接访问数组的元素    数组指针的定义:       int *p;    数组指针的初始化:       int a[4]={1,2,3,4};

2015-07-24 13:40:37 306

原创 黑马程序员-----C语言学习之函数

函数:它是完成特定功能的代码段,也是构成我们c语言源程序的基本单位;  优点:1>提高程序的可读性;            2>提高开发的效率;            3>提高代码的重用性;函数使用的流程:都是  先声明--》定义--》调用;如果函数类型是整形的话int可以省略 例如 max(){}它表示默认是一个整型的函数 只是省略了max前面的int;一般不建议省略

2015-07-20 23:10:08 309

原创 黑马程序员-----C语言学习之循环结构

循环结构:当条件满足的时候,程序会重复的执行某一个代码段,这就是循环结构。构成循环结构要素1>循环控制条件                2>循环体                3>能够让循环结束的语句(递增、递减、真、假)while循环的格式当型循环指的是先判断条件 在执行循环体;        while(表达式){

2015-07-20 23:02:50 328

原创 黑马程序员-----C语言学习之预处理指令

------- Windows Phone 7手机开发、.Net培训、期待与您交流! -------运算符:算术运算符、赋值运算符、复合赋值运算符、自增自减运算符、sizeof运算符、逗号运算符、关系运算符、逻辑运算符;也可以分为: 单目运算符、双目运算符、三目运算符;运算符的结合性(前提是优先级必须相同)分为:左结合性、右结合性;运算符的优先级:

2015-07-19 17:08:35 297

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除